Windows Server 用ラップトップのドライバー

Windows Server 用ラップトップのドライバー

ノートパソコンを持ち運べる「モバイル サーバー」を構築したいと考えています。そこで、Windows Server をインストールしましたが、一部のドライバーが動作しません (タッチスクリーンやネットワークなど)。これらのドライバーは Windows の Home インストールで動作するため、調査してみました。

主な問題はネットワーク カードでした。ドライバーをインストールすると、「.inf ファイルにサービスに関する間違った情報が含まれています」というメッセージが表示されます。x32 に関する記述をすべて削除しようとしましたが、うまくいきませんでした。

どうすればいいでしょうか? ISO を変更してドライバーを含めることができると聞きました。これでうまくいくでしょうか?

答え1

コメントで説明されているように、あなたが遭遇した問題は、ラップトップのさまざまなコンポーネントのハードウェア ベンダーが Windows Server 用のドライバーを作成していないことが原因です。OS 用のドライバーの開発にはコストがかかるため、賢明なメーカーは、ターゲット市場でドライバーが必要ない場合は、これを行いません。

通常、必要なドライバーがあることを事前に確認したアドオン コンポーネントをインストールすることで、この問題を回避できます。ただし、これはラップトップなので、難しい可能性があります。

代替案: 仮想化

ラップトップが仮想化をサポートしている場合は、それを使用して「仮想マシン」(VM) で目的のサーバー OS を実行できます。

マシンの仮想化を提供するソフトウェアはハイパーバイザーです。ハイパーバイザーは他のアプリケーションと同様にコンピューター上で実行されるため、インストールされたハードウェア固有のドライバー ソフトウェアを介してコンピューターのハードウェア サービス (オーディオやイーサネット接続など) にアクセスできます。

VM として実行される「ゲスト」オペレーティング システムはハードウェアに直接アクセスできないため、デバイス固有のドライバーは必要ありません。代わりに、ゲスト OS と物理環境のハードウェア間の通信は仮想化ソフトウェアによって処理されます。ゲスト OS に必要なすべてのドライバー (仮想ネットワーク カード、仮想ストレージ コントローラーなど) は仮想化ソフトウェアで提供され、VM のゲスト OS にインストールできます (インボックス ドライバーとしてまだインストールされていない場合)。

結論:物理ハードウェアに必要な特定のドライバーを気にすることなく、OS を VM として実行できます。


*これはハイパーバイザーの仕組みを単純化して説明したものです。この投稿の有用性を高めないような詳細な説明は省略します。

関連情報